Matthew 8:23-27
Jesus
Calms The Storm
8:23
When He got into the boat, His disciples followed
Him.
24 And behold, there arose
a great storm on the sea, so that the boat was
being covered with the waves; but Jesus Himself was
asleep.
25 And they came to Him
and woke Him, saying, "Save us, Lord; we are
perishing!"
26 He said to them, "Why
are you afraid, you men of little faith?" Then He
got up and rebuked the winds and the sea, and it
became perfectly calm.
27 The men were amazed,
and said, "What kind of a man is this, that even
the winds and the sea obey Him?"

About The
Storm
The disciples were mostly
fishermen and set out across the Sea of Galilee
just as they had many times before. But, a sudden
storm took them by surprise and feared for their
lives.
Jesus had performed many
miracles before this even so the disciples were
perfectly aware of His power yet, they were
terrified and began to panic.
Even with His great powers,
the disciples did not comprehend the scope of what
Jesus could do so the thought never occurred to
them that He could control the weather. As we often
do, they underestimated the power of
God.
